Transaction fd667e21eee022892e624a90b21a30b73c52b46f9af8b276d494959d5761ce85

1 Input
2 Outputs
  • fd667e21eee022892e624a90b21a30b73c52b46f9af8b276d494959d5761ce85:0
  • value  2918564767
    address  1Jgz44PwZQKU5CWXQJ6JHhJ9wXET4PaJba
  • fd667e21eee022892e624a90b21a30b73c52b46f9af8b276d494959d5761ce85:1
  • value  276299
    address  18u5jX1YNSkNMwS743fsnpn77nAyAspjQg